The Freedom Luncheon and Angels of Trafficking Award is an event dedicated to raising awareness about human trafficking and honoring individuals or organizations who have made significant contributions to fighting it. The luncheon typically features speakers, survivor stories, the 2024/2025 BSCC report, and the presentation of the Angels of Trafficking Award to recognize outstanding advocacy, support, and impact in the movement toward freedom and justice for trafficking victims.

Welcome to the Kuhner Shaker Symposium and Mini Conference!
Join us on
Wed J
une 11th
at the
Hyatt Regency - La Jolla
for a full scientific program with seminars from industrial partners and guest speakers. Ample networking and learning opportunities are included and we will also be showcasing our newest automated shaker, the MPS-Z.
Don't miss out on this event where industry experts share their knowledge and experience alongside theoretical and practical applications guidance from technology developers. Whether you're a seasoned professional or just starting out in the field, there's something for everyone at the Kuhner Shaker Symposium and Mini Conference.
Who should participate?
In addition to the scientific program and networking opportunities, the symposium will be particularly useful to those cultivating mammalian and microbial cells using shakers. This includes cell biologists, bioengineers, cell culture and fermentation scientists, chemical engineers in research and development, process development, technology transfer and associated management roles.
We will review how adjustments made to shaker attributes (e.g. speed, diameter, humidification), vessel attributes (e.g. size, shape, fill volume, feeding, construction material, baffling systems, closure shape and type) and vessel selection (e.g. well plates, tubes, flasks, bioreactors) must be considered together. We will discuss how changes to any of these variables impact the scalability of cultivation results.
For 2025 we will be further focusing on automation of shaker-scale cultivations and will highlight innovations in automation and control of your workflows.
On completion of the symposium, participants will have a thorough understanding of how to impact desired changes in mixing times, kLa and shear stress (incl. liquid velocity) across a multiple cultivation system. No advanced training necessary. Knowledge about your current cultivation practices and culture needs will be helpful during question-and-answer periods.
